Timezone in Sermoyer
Sermoyer is located in the Europe/Paris timezone, which operates on a UTC offset of +1 during standard time. This changes to UTC +2 during daylight saving time, which typically begins on the last Sunday in March and ends on the last Sunday in October. During this period, clocks are set forward one hour to make better use of daylight.
When considering the time difference with the United States, it is important to note that Sermoyer is generally ahead of Eastern Standard Time by six hours and ahead of Pacific Standard Time by nine hours. This means that when it is noon in Sermoyer, it is 6 AM in New York and 3 AM in Los Angeles.
